Hi,

I'm applying styling to the map, and viewing the map inside Safari on iPhone4 (not simulator, real iphone).   I see for a split second the default map color when the map loads, as well as when I pan and new tiles are loaded.

The API underlays a static map, which is then hidden by 'proper'
tiles.

Ok, using  useStaticMap:false resolves the problem.

Do take note it is an undocumented option, it might disappear.
